Payment

Tuition installments

Description
  • If you are unable to pay the full tuition fee within the registration period due to personal reasons such as financial difficulties, you can apply in advance for tuition installment payment.
  • Eligibility
    • Currently enrolled students and returning students (including those exceeding the standard duration of study) at the university.
    • Installment payment is available only to applying students, and newly admitted or transfer students are not eligible to apply for installment payment.

      Students exceeding the standard duration of study

      • Undergraduate: Students registered for 9 semesters or more (however, for the Architecture major, students registered for 11 semesters or more)
      • Graduate School, Design Graduate School, Tax Graduate School: Students registered for 5 semesters or more
      • Professional Graduate School: Students registered for 6 semesters or more
      • Law School: Students registered for 7 semesters or more
    • For those exceeding the standard duration of study, in the case of undergraduates, this applies only if they have registered for 10 credits or more, and for graduate students, if they have registered for 4 credits or more.
    Installments
    • 4 installments
    Payment amount
    • 25% for each installment
    Installment payment application period
    • The application period will be announced separately before the start of each semester.

    Note
    • If the first installment is not paid after applying for installment payment, the application will be invalidated, and the full tuition amount must be paid during the additional registration period.
    • Applicants for government-guaranteed student loans are restricted in installment payment options.
    • If you take a leave of absence after paying at least one installment, you must pay the remaining tuition amount in full to be able to apply for a leave of absence (please refer to the timeline for general leave of absence).

      Example) If you wish to take a leave of absence after the first installment: payment of the 2nd, 3rd, and 4th installments is required. If you wish to take a leave of absence after the 2nd installment: payment of the 3rd and 4th installments is required.

    • If the tuition is not fully paid by the deadline for the 4th installment after the 1st installment payment, the student will be processed for deregistration due to non-registration.
    • For students who have completed the 1st installment payment, they can apply by phone (02-6490-6432) to pay the remaining amount combined with the next installment payment until 7 days before the start of the next payment period.

      Example) 2nd Installment Payment Period: Combined payment for the 2nd, 3rd, and 4th installments; 3rd installment payment period: combined payment for the 3rd and 4th installments.

    Tuition differential payment

    Eligibility
    • Undergraduate: Students registered for 9 semesters or more; however, students registered for 11 semesters or more for architecture major
    • Graduate School, Design Graduate School, Tax Graduate School: Students registered for 5 semesters or more
    • Professional Graduate School: Students registered for 6 semesters or more
    • Law School: Students registered for 7 semesters or more
    Tuition amount by registered credits
    • Undergraduate (including architecture major)
      table
      Registered credits Tuition amount
      Those who registered for courses without credits 1/12 of tuition
      1 to 3 credits 1/6 of tuition
      4 to 6 credits 1/3 of tuition
      7 to 9 credits 1/2 of tuition
      10+ credits Full tuition
    • Graduate school (including general, professional, and specialized)
      table
      Registered credits Tuition amount
      Those who registered for courses without credits 1/6 of tuition
      1 to 3 credits 1/2 of tuition
      4+ credits Full tuition
